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(1)

Issue 6596044: Add onChange event to preference extension APIs. (Closed)

Created:
9 years, 9 months ago by Bernhard Bauer
Modified:
9 years, 7 months ago
Reviewers:
battre
CC:
chromium-reviews, Aaron Boodman, Erik does not do reviews, brettw-cc_chromium.org, pam+watch_chromium.org, darin-cc_chromium.org, jochen (gone - plz use gerrit)
Visibility:
Public.

Description

Add onChange event to preference extension APIs. BUG=73994 TEST=TBD Committed: http://src.chromium.org/viewvc/chrome?view=rev&revision=78354

Patch Set 1 #

Patch Set 2 : deal with incognito mode #

Patch Set 3 : '' #

Patch Set 4 : lotta stuff #

Patch Set 5 : remove unnecessary files #

Patch Set 6 : sync #

Patch Set 7 : sync #

Patch Set 8 : test #

Total comments: 13

Patch Set 9 : review #

Patch Set 10 : sync #

Patch Set 11 : sync #

Patch Set 12 : fix #

Total comments: 1
Unified diffs Side-by-side diffs Delta from patch set Stats (+610 lines, -24 lines) Patch
M chrome/browser/extensions/extension_content_settings_apitest.cc View 1 2 3 4 5 1 chunk +11 lines, -0 lines 0 comments Download
M chrome/browser/extensions/extension_preference_api.h View 1 2 3 4 5 6 7 8 9 10 2 chunks +29 lines, -6 lines 0 comments Download
M chrome/browser/extensions/extension_preference_api.cc View 1 2 3 4 5 6 7 8 9 10 11 7 chunks +135 lines, -18 lines 1 comment Download
M chrome/browser/extensions/extension_service.h View 1 2 3 4 5 6 7 8 9 2 chunks +3 lines, -0 lines 0 comments Download
M chrome/browser/extensions/extension_service.cc View 1 2 3 4 5 6 10 3 chunks +3 lines, -0 lines 0 comments Download
M chrome/common/extensions/api/extension_api.json View 1 2 3 4 5 6 7 8 9 1 chunk +28 lines, -0 lines 0 comments Download
M chrome/common/extensions/docs/experimental.extension.html View 1 2 3 4 5 6 7 8 2 chunks +299 lines, -0 lines 0 comments Download
A chrome/test/data/extensions/api_test/content_settings/onchange/manifest.json View 1 2 3 1 chunk +7 lines, -0 lines 0 comments Download
A chrome/test/data/extensions/api_test/content_settings/onchange/test.html View 1 2 3 4 5 6 7 8 1 chunk +95 lines, -0 lines 0 comments Download

Messages

Total messages: 6 (0 generated)
Bernhard Bauer
Please review.
9 years, 9 months ago (2011-03-09 18:56:58 UTC) #1
battre
Do we need to update the API documentation? http://codereview.chromium.org/6596044/diff/14003/chrome/browser/extensions/extension_preference_api.cc File chrome/browser/extensions/extension_preference_api.cc (right): http://codereview.chromium.org/6596044/diff/14003/chrome/browser/extensions/extension_preference_api.cc#newcode92 chrome/browser/extensions/extension_preference_api.cc:92: // ...
9 years, 9 months ago (2011-03-10 13:07:28 UTC) #2
Bernhard Bauer
On 2011/03/10 13:07:28, battre wrote: > Do we need to update the API documentation? Added ...
9 years, 9 months ago (2011-03-10 14:51:15 UTC) #3
battre
http://codereview.chromium.org/6596044/diff/14003/chrome/browser/extensions/extension_preference_api.cc File chrome/browser/extensions/extension_preference_api.cc (right): http://codereview.chromium.org/6596044/diff/14003/chrome/browser/extensions/extension_preference_api.cc#newcode159 chrome/browser/extensions/extension_preference_api.cc:159: OnPrefChanged(Source<PrefService>(source).ptr(), *pref_key); On 2011/03/10 14:51:15, Bernhard Bauer wrote: > ...
9 years, 9 months ago (2011-03-11 09:28:36 UTC) #4
Bernhard Bauer
On 2011/03/11 09:28:36, battre wrote: > http://codereview.chromium.org/6596044/diff/14003/chrome/browser/extensions/extension_preference_api.cc > File chrome/browser/extensions/extension_preference_api.cc (right): > > http://codereview.chromium.org/6596044/diff/14003/chrome/browser/extensions/extension_preference_api.cc#newcode159 > ...
9 years, 9 months ago (2011-03-15 17:35:15 UTC) #5
battre
9 years, 9 months ago (2011-03-16 13:07:35 UTC) #6
LGTM

http://codereview.chromium.org/6596044/diff/28001/chrome/browser/extensions/e...
File chrome/browser/extensions/extension_preference_api.cc (right):

http://codereview.chromium.org/6596044/diff/28001/chrome/browser/extensions/e...
chrome/browser/extensions/extension_preference_api.cc:179: // Mapping from
browser pref keys to extension event names.
"to extension event names" is not quite correct, is it? event names and
permissions

Powered by Google App Engine
This is Rietveld 408576698